Utilisateur de longue date du système de commentaires Disqus, le premier article datait de 2014, j’ai toujours pensé que l’aspect social qui manquait autour de WordPress pouvait être contourné en ayant recourt à une extension ou un système comme Disqus.
Constat
Le principe est simple, l’extension remplace et se superpose à votre système de commentaires intégré à WordPress tout en proposant des fonctionnalités additionnelles. De mon point de vue, l’un des aspects intéressants est qu’un visiteur puisse s’identifier et participer sur un article sans avoir à se créer un compte sur le site ou Disqus mais qu’il puisse utiliser un autre fournisseur d’identité comme Google, Twitter, Facebook en fonction de ce qu’il arrange. De ce fait, il n’est plus nécessaire de s’inscrire et je me disais que cela pouvait améliorer le taux de participation.
Mais finalement après plusieurs années d’utilisation, j’ai décidé de supprimer cette extension du site et de revenir aux commentaires proposés par WordPress.
Plusieurs raisons à l’abandon de Disqus
- Le système de commentaire étant géré par une société externe cela ralentit nécessairement l’affichage du site – en particulier quand on arrive à la section des commentaires. Ce n’est pas forcément gênant aujourd’hui sur le PC mais cela peut l’être pour les visiteurs en mobilité sur leur smartphone ou tablette. Je ne vais pas refaire l’analyse mais vous pouvez retrouver des tests métrologiques réalisés par d’autres internautes en consultant les sites suivants :
- Le système n’est désormais plus gratuit. En effet, initialement proposé gratuitement, l’extension est désormais payante au prix de 12 $ / mois soit 144 $ / an auquel vous devrez ajouter la TVA. Donc globalement on est autour de 135 € / an. Sur le papier, je conçois que le service soit payant simplement is le montant n’est rien pour les sites à fort traffic ce n’est pas neutre pour les sites à faible trafic. Si vous l’utilisez gratuitement, vous aurez la joie de découvrir d’immondes publicités (honnêtement c’est vraiment les pires publicités possibles) sur votre site. J’en avais parlé dans un précédent article sur lequel vous pourrez voir un exemple de publicités.
- Aucune innovation. A part des changements graphiques et cosmétiques, l’entreprise donne l’impression de ne strictement rien faire pour faire évoluer son produit. A part le design, la zone de commentaires ou les fonctionnalités n’ont pas bougé depuis 2014.
- Même si vous acceptez de payer, soyez conscient que les données générées autour des commentaires sont analysées par Disqus pour faire de l’argent et vendre ces informations aux annonceurs. Ces dernières années et depuis Google qui lit les mails dans Gmail – il semble que ce ne soit plus la tendance et que nous ayons pris conscience de cette curiosité mal placée.
Comment supprimer Disqus probablement sans rien perdre ?
Avant de démarrer, il est important de comprendre le fonctionnement interne de Disqus. A partir du moment où vous choisissez d’utiliser ce système, les commentaires futurs de votre site ne seront plus dans votre BDD ou dans votre WordPress mais seront contenus dans Disqus ! C’est pour cela que vous verrez probablement une différence entre le nombre de commentaires dans votre panneau d’admin WordPress et dans Disqus.
Synchronisation des commentaires
Cela signifie que si on veut se débarrasser de Disqus mais sans perdre de contenu, nous devons d’abord récupérer tous les commentaires qui sont dans Disqus pour les remettre dans notre WordPress. Pour ce faire Disqus propose une fonctionnalité de « synchronisation » des commentaires. Elle peut être automatique ou manuelle.
Vous pouvez retrouver cette option dans les réglages de votre extension Disqus donc ne la supprimez pas encore. 🙃
Dans un premier temps, j’ai testé la synchronisation automatique et ça n’a pas fonctionné. Soyons clair, cette option existe uniquement dans l’optique d’abandonner Disqus car sinon la société n’a aucun besoin de vous laisser avoir une copie de vos commentaires sur votre site. Donc ce n’est sûrement pas une coïncidence si ça ne marche pas terrible. J’ai testé plusieurs fois et rien ne s’est produit.
Après cet échec, j’ai donc utilisé l’option de synchronisation manuelle. Le principe c’est que vous définissez une plage que Disqus va utiliser pour récupérer tous vos commentaires et les reporter / copier dans votre WordPress. J’ai eu un meilleur résultat mais là encore il y a une limitation puisque l’extension n’est capable que gérer qu’une période de 1 année. Autrement dit, si vous avez commencé à utiliser Disqus depuis 10 ans vous allez devoir faire cette synchronisation manuellement à 10 reprises en modifiant la date de début et date de fin.
Là encore, en ce qui me concerne lorsque je mettais des plages de 12 mois ou 6 mois, la synchronisation s’arrêtait en plein milieu et je devais recommencer encore et encore. Je ne connais pas les raisons de ces difficultés peut-être un caractère spécifique dans un commentaire – je l’ignore. Toujours est-il que si j’ai un conseil à donner c’est de faire cette synchronisation par périodes de 3 à 6 mois maximum. Personnellement c’est ce que j’ai fait et même si c’est pénible ça a beaucoup mieux marché.
Suppression de l’extension Disqus dans WordPress
Une fois la synchronisation terminée, j’ai pu vérifier dans le portail admin de WordPress que le nombre de commentaires avait augmenté et que j’avais bien récupérer les commentaires qui concernaient les articles les plus récents – depuis la mise en place de Disqus.
A ce moment-là, vous avez récupéré tous vos commentaires dans WordPress, vous pouvez donc purement et simplement désactiver l’extension pour supprimer Disqus de votre site. Vous allez retrouver votre site avec la présentation standardisée des commentaires au bas de chaque article.
Suppression de votre site dans le portail Disqus
Pour ma part, je souhaite pouvoir continuer à utiliser mon compte Disqus pour participer aux sites qui continuent de l’utiliser. Je ne souhaite donc pas simprimer « tout Disqus » mais simplement la gestion de mon site. Pour ce faire, vous devez aller suivre la documentation suivante : https://help.disqus.com/en/articles/1717289-how-do-i-remove-my-site et supprimer votre site de Disqus. De ce fait, vous ne supprimer pas TOUT votre compte Disqus.
Vous devrez confirmer avec votre mot de passe. Attention la suppression prend quelques secondes et est irréversible donc réfléchissez bien ! 😮
Nettoyage de la base de données
Pour ceux qui le souhaiteraient, vous pouvez également suivre cette étape de nettoyage de la base de données SQL des informations spécifiques Disqus. Les étapes sont documentées sur l’article suivant : https://crunchify.com/have-you-removed-disqus-now-its-time-to-clean-up-comment-metadata/ et il semblerait que les tables soient toutes identifiables avec un préfixe disqus_ ou bien dsq_.
Pour ma part, je n’ai pas exécuté cette partie et par rapport à la taille de ma base de données je pense que c’est anecdotique. A vous de voir – dans tous les cas, n’oubliez pas de faire un backup de votre base de données avant les changements. 🙃
Pour la suite ?
Pour l’instant, je vais tenter d’utiliser les commentaires WordPress classiques. Il y a quand même des limitations : on ne peut pas ajouter d’images facilement ou encore des liens internes/externes. A voir si je tente à nouveau un autre système de commentaires comme Hyvor ou wpDisquz.